For the meantime, his script for /etc/NetworkManager/dispatcher.d/: #! /bin/bash REQUIRED_CONNECTION_NAME="<Connection1>" VPN_CONNECTION_NAME="<VpnConnection1>" activ_con=$(nmcli con status | grep "${REQUIRED_CONNECTION_NAME}") activ_vpn=$(nmcli con status | grep "${VPN_CONNECTION_NAME}") if [ "${activ_con}" -a ! "${activ_vpn}" ]; then nmcli con up id "${VPN_CONNECTION_NAME}" fi -- You received this bug notification because you are a member of Desktop Packages, which is subscribed to network-manager in Ubuntu. https://bugs.launchpad.net/bugs/280571 Title: NetworkManager does not auto-connect to VPNs marked "Connect Automatically" Status in NetworkManager: Confirmed Status in “network-manager” package in Ubuntu: Triaged Status in Debian GNU/Linux: New Bug description: VPN connections marked "Connect Automatically" are not activated when a wired or wireless network becomes available.
